July 8, 2020 Opinion or Order Filing 223 ORDER. IT IS HEREBY ORDERED THAT: Telephonic and Video Conferencing Solutions. The trial shall take place virtually using both telephonic and video conferencing solutions as set forth herein. All counsel who participate in the trial shall participate in appropriate pre-trial technology testing as may be required by further order of the Court. Access. No later than July 8, 2020 at 5:00 p.m., the parties shall provide to the Court via ECF a list of all (a) attorneys participating in the trial, alo ng with their phone numbers and email addresses, and (b) witnesses who will participate in the trial. The public is invited to attend the trial on a non-speaking basis by utilizing a dial-in number that will be provided on the docket. Remote Witness Testimony. Rule 43(a) of the Federal Rules of Civil Procedure provides that, for "good cause in compelling circumstances," a witness may be permitted to testify by contemporaneous transmission from a location other than the courtroom. Havin g found that good cause in compelling circumstances exist here due to the COVID-19 pandemic, any witness called to testify at the trial shall testify by contemporaneous transmission from a different location than the courtroom ("Remote Witness&q uot;), and as further specified herein regarding Remote Witness Testimony. Submission of Exhibits. By July 13, 2020, (1) all exhibits that will be used at trial shall be saved on a USB drive and mailed to the undersigned, and (2) all deposition trans cripts that will be used at trial shall be e-mailed to Chambers at the following e-mail address: McCarthy_NYSDchambers@nysd.uscourts.gov. Courtroom Formalities. Although being conducted using video conferencing solutions, the trial constitutes a court proceeding, and any recording other than the official court version is prohibited. No party may record images or sounds from any location. The formalities of a courtroom must be observed. So ordered. (Signed by Magistrate Judge Judith C. McCarthy on 7/8/2020) (rjm)
